What is the name of this meatball recipe?
The recipe is for Hearty Venison and Beef Meatballs in Savory Mushroom Gravy.
What types of meat are used in these meatballs?
The meatballs are made using a combination of hot sausage and either ground beef or ground venison.
How much hot sausage is required?
The recipe calls for 1 lb of hot sausage, specifically the roll variety.
When should I add melted butter to the meat mixture?
You should add 4 tablespoons of melted butter only if you are using ground venison to compensate for its leanness.
What is the purpose of the breadcrumbs in this recipe?
Breadcrumbs are used as a binding agent to help the meatballs hold their shape.
Is there an optional ingredient for the meatball texture?
Yes, you can optionally add 2 slices of torn and wet bread to the mixture.
How much onion is needed and how should it be prepared?
You need 1/2 cup of onion, which should be chopped finely.
How many eggs are used for binding?
The recipe uses 2 beaten eggs.
What spices are used to season the meatballs?
The meatballs are seasoned with salt, pepper, garlic powder, thyme, basil, and parsley.
How much Worcestershire sauce is used in total?
A total of 6 tablespoons is used: 4 tablespoons in the meat mixture and 2 tablespoons reserved for the gravy.
How should the meatballs be shaped?
Scoop out 1/4 cup of the mixture and form it into thick, round patties rather than perfectly round balls.
What type of skillet is recommended for cooking the patties?
A cast iron skillet is recommended for browning the patties.
How long do you cook the patties in the skillet?
Cook the patties for about 4-5 minutes per side until they are well browned.
How many mushrooms are included in the gravy?
The recipe uses 16 oz of fresh mushrooms, washed and sliced thin or quartered.
What should I do with the mushroom stems?
The mushroom stems should be minced and added back into the pot with the meatballs.
How many garlic cloves are added to the gravy?
The recipe calls for 3 crushed garlic cloves for the gravy mixture.
What is the role of Kitchen Bouquet in this recipe?
One tablespoon of Kitchen Bouquet is used to add rich color and flavor to the gravy.
How is the gravy roux made?
Whisk 4 tablespoons of flour into the remaining fat in the skillet and brown it slightly before adding water.
How much water is added to the roux to make the gravy?
Gradually add 2-3 cups of water while whisking continuously to achieve a thick, dark brown consistency.
How many bay leaves are used for flavoring?
The recipe uses 1 1/2 bay leaves.
What is the purpose of the beef base or bouillon cube?
It is used to enhance the beef flavor of the savory mushroom gravy.
How long does the entire dish need to simmer?
Once the gravy is poured over the meatballs and brought to a boil, it should simmer on low for 1 1/2 hours.
How can I make the gravy even thicker if needed?
You can thicken the gravy further using a cornstarch slurry, which is cornstarch mixed with water.
What are the recommended sides for this meal?
The meatballs and gravy are best served over steaming rice or creamy mashed potatoes.
How many meatballs should I serve per guest?
Due to the richness of the dish, plan for 1-2 meatballs per serving.
Can this recipe be prepared in advance?
Yes, these meatballs are ideal for make-ahead meals and can be frozen for future dinners.
Is it necessary to stir the pot during simmering?
Yes, you should stir occasionally to gently mix the ingredients without breaking the meatballs.

What is the texture of the meatballs supposed to be like?
The mixture should be firm enough to shape into patties but remain succulent and moist once cooked.
Does the recipe allow for spice adjustments?
Yes, the description encourages adjusting the spices to suit your own personal palate.
